Cerro Cuello
Cerro Cuello is a peak in Hidalgo, Central Mexico and has an elevation of 3,048 metres. Cerro Cuello is situated nearby to the village Buenavista, as well as near Santiago Cuaula.| Tap on a place to explore it |
